Handover for the weekly eng sync: I'm transferring ownership of Duskrunner, our nightly backfill scheduler, to Priya. Current state: all jobs healthy except the ledger-reconciliation backfill, which retries once nightly due to a slow upstream from the Kestwick warehouse. Retry logic, window sizing, and concurrency caps were all tuned carefully last quarter — please don't change them without a load test. For full transparency at the sync, the production instance runs with these configuration values.

settings of hawep-kadug:
RALAEL_HOST=ralael.tolvaqlabs.internal
RALAEL_PORT=9000

**Changelog — Poolhouse v2.4.1**

Quick note for support: we rotated the deploy key used by the Poolhouse connection-pooling service. Connection limits and timeouts are unchanged, so any pool-exhaustion tickets aren't related. Agents running pre-rotation builds will log a verification warning until they update. The currently valid key is the following.

rollout seal: bky4_x7Gc

## Report Builder Data Stores

Quick note for anyone new: the Pelterin report builder sorts in two passes, and only the second pass is stable. If your grouped reports look shuffled, that's why — always add a tiebreaker column. Sorting happens in the warehouse, not the app. To poke around yourself, connect using this.

replica DSN, yahog-kawig: redis://istox_svc:um@db-8a67.halixforge.test:5432/frawyn